The Basics of South Korean Won and U.S. Dollar
The South Korean won, abbreviated as KRW, is the official currency of South Korea. It is issued by the Bank of Korea and plays a vital role in the country’s economy, which is driven by industries such as technology, automotive, shipbuilding, and finance. On the other hand, the U.S. dollar, abbreviated as USD, is the most widely used reserve currency in the world. It serves as the benchmark for global trade, oil pricing, and international settlements.

Calculating 45.6 Million Won to USD
To convert 45.6 million won to USD, you need to check the latest exchange rate. Suppose the current rate is 1,300 KRW = 1 USD (this is just an example rate for explanation).
- 45,600,000 KRW ÷ 1,300 = approximately 35,077 USD
If the rate changes to 1,350 KRW = 1 USD, then the same amount of won would equal around 33,777 USD. This demonstrates how sensitive large amounts of money can be to even small changes in exchange rates.
Why Exchange Rates Fluctuate
The value of 45.6 million won in USD does not remain constant because exchange rates fluctuate daily. Some of the main factors include:
- Economic stability: If South Korea’s economy is performing well, the won tends to strengthen against the dollar.
- Interest rates: Higher interest rates in South Korea can attract foreign investments, raising the demand for won and impacting its exchange value.
- Inflation: Lower inflation rates often support a stronger currency.
- Trade balances: Since South Korea exports heavily, trade surpluses can strengthen the won, while deficits can weaken it.
- Global events: Political changes, natural disasters, and global crises such as pandemics can all impact currency values.

The Importance of Timing in Conversion
Timing can make a big difference. Imagine converting 45.6 million won when the exchange rate is 1,280 KRW per dollar compared to 1,350 KRW per dollar. The difference could be over 2,000 USD, which is significant for tuition, investments, or business deals. Many individuals watch the forex market closely before deciding to make large conversions.
